Chrysler is recalling certain 2020-2024 Jeep Gladiator and 2018-2024 Jeep Wrangler vehicles because their instrument panels can fail to show speedometer or warning lights, which may increase crash risk. Owners should contact dealers for free replacement.
The instrument panel cluster can develop an internal short circuit and fail to display critical safety information like speedometer readings or warning lights. This may lead to drivers not being aware of important vehicle conditions, increasing crash risk.

Dealers will replace the instrument panel cluster,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ed between October 3, 2024, and January 23, 2025. Owners may contact FCA customer service at 1-800-853-1403. FCA's number for this recall is 30B.
